Yukon Blonde Announce 'Tiger Talk' LP

BY Gregory AdamsPublished Jan 24, 2012

BC-based retro rockers Yukon Blonde promised fans a new punk-inspired LP by the spring, and it looks as if the group will be keeping their promise. Hot off the heels of their Fire//Water EP and the "Stairway"/"Radio" seven-inch, the act have officially announced their sophomore LP, Tiger Talk. It's set to arrive March 20 through Dine Alone Records.

As previously reported, the ten-song outing was recorded at Burnaby, BC's Hive Creative Labs with producer Colin Stewart (Black Mountain, Ladyhawk). The record is said to feature the same kind of hook-heavy tunes Yukon Blonde are known for, while offering up a new side of the act via some late '70s/early '80s post-punk and new wave influences.

A press release points to "Oregon Shores" for its face-melting solos, but other highlights are said to include the previously released, Elvis Costello-inspired "Radio," and the power pop "whoa-ohs" of "My Girl." You can check out the tracklist below, and grab the lead single "Stairway" here
